Leadership Overview

Torc Robotics has 4 executives leading key functions including finance, operations, technology, and people.

Driven by innovation, Torc Robotics delivers autonomous vehicles for safety-critical applications, shaping the future of transportation with advanced engineering and a commitment to operational excellence.

Leadership Roles at Torc Robotics

  • Chief Financial Officer - Richard Kannan
  • Chief of Staff - Kayla Smith
  • Chief Technology Officer - Charles CJ King
  • Chief People Officer - Marnie Young
